Transfield Carols this Thursday 17th!

Love Makes a Way would like to invite you to a Carols Service at Broadspectrum (Transfield).

WHEN: 5pm (sharp) to 6pm on 17 Dec. 2015. (This is a slight change from the 4pm start advertised in last week’s email update).

WHERE: Out the front of Broadspectrum (Transfield) Offices – 509 St Kilda Rd, Melbourne

WHAT: Singing Christmas Carols and following a simple Christmas liturgy that tells the story of Christmas

DRESS CODE: Smart casual, Clergy please wear whatever marks you in your role. If you have a LMAW t-shirt, feel free to wear that. Children may dress up as members of the nativity

BRING: your singing voice, instruments if you are willing to accompany carols, signs that call Broadspectrum to stop their involvement in detaining children and their families, or signs that bring light to the Christmas story like “Jesus was a refugee” or “Christmas is a time to welcome”

We would also like to make clear that this is NOT going to be a civil disobedience action; in the case of being asked to move away by police we will do so peacefully and walk together as a group around the outside of the office building to continue in the large public park at the back.

Please be encouraged to bring friends of any faith, so long as they are prepared to keep the nonviolent and peaceful spirit of Love Makes A Way actions.
